Zephyr For iPhone Updated; Now Allows You to Close an App With a Swipe

Grant Paul a.k.a chpwn - iOS developer and hacker, who has released jailbreak apps such as Spire - the legal Siri port to non-iPhone 4S had released a jailbreak tweak called Zephyr, which brought some cool multitasking gestures to the iPhone and iPod touch to access multitasking tray or to switch between apps.

chpwn has just released a new version of Zephyr, which includes the following changes:

  • Swipe up to close an app (note that it doesn't close an app but it takes you to the home screen, it has the same effect as tapping on the Home button)
  • Quickly horizontally swipe between many different apps.
  • Pause while swiping up to quickly show the multitasking switcher.
  • Improved performance and many bug fixes.

With the latest update, Zephyr will be very helpful for users who have an iOS device with a broken or less responsive Home button. It is also a cool way to reduce the wear and tear of the Home button.

Zephyr is available on Cydia for $2.99.
